Situated in South West England, Bristol is a historic port city, built on wine, tobacco and the notorious slave trade. Badly damaged in WWII, the city has since been regenerated with a large new shopping centre, great museums and multiple waterside restaurants and bars
The City of Cambridge is dominated by its university, founded in the 13th century. Its many historic buildings include the gothic Kings College Chapel and Trinity College. There is a great choice of interesting museums and other attractions, including punting on the River Cam.
